Attractions and Places To See around Mondim De Basto - Top 17

Best attractions and places to see around Mondim De Basto, a municipality in northern Portugal's Vila Real district, offers a rich landscape of natural beauty and historical sites. The region is characterized by its rugged mountains, such as Monte Farinha, and significant rivers like the Olo and Tâmega. Visitors can explore diverse natural features, including impressive waterfalls and parts of the Alvão Natural Park. The area also features traditional villages and historical landmarks, providing a glimpse into local heritage.

A peaceful route with stunning views over the Tâmega River; in autumn, enjoy the falling leaves and their variety of colors. A safe place to cycle – be careful when crossing local roads, which are usually marked. At a sporting level, sufficiently challenging – 80 kilometers and 800 meters of elevation gain (round trip between Amarante and Arco de Baulhe). Restaurants and/or bars are available at the Gatão, Celorico, and Mondim de Basto train stations.

Frequently Asked Questions

Where can I find impressive waterfalls and natural swimming spots in Mondim de Basto?

Mondim de Basto is home to the stunning Fisgas de Ermelo Waterfalls, among the largest in Europe. Here, the Olo River cascades down cliffs, forming natural swimming pools during warmer months. Another excellent spot for a refreshing swim, accessible only by hiking, is Upper Piocas, which is also a popular lunch break location.

What historical landmarks can I explore in Mondim de Basto?

You can step back in time at the medieval Castle of Arnoia, the only castle on the Romanesque Route, offering sweeping views. The iconic Senhora da Graça Sanctuary, perched atop Monte Farinha, provides breathtaking panoramic views and a unique connection to the region's heritage. Don't miss the Arco de Baúlhe Railway Station, which now hosts a museum, or the historic Ponte do Cabril, a medieval bridge crossing the Cabril River.

Are there good hiking trails around Mondim de Basto?

Yes, the region offers diverse hiking opportunities. You can explore trails through the fragrant pine forests and rocky landscapes leading to the Fisgas de Ermelo Waterfalls. The Alvão Natural Park also provides extensive trails through its unique biodiversity. For more structured routes, you can find various options in the Running Trails around Mondim De Basto guide, including the challenging 'Ermelo Village loop from Ermelo e Pardelhas'.

What cycling opportunities are available in the Mondim de Basto area?

Cyclists can enjoy the picturesque Tâmega Line Ecotrail, which offers serene views, especially beautiful in autumn. This cycling 'highway' over old train tracks provides a safe and scenic route. For more detailed routes, check out the Cycling around Mondim De Basto guide, which includes routes like the 'Circular Route 13 of Mondim de Basto — Alvão Natural Park' and the 'Celorico de Basto Ecotrail – Tâmega Line Greenway loop'.

Where are the best viewpoints to enjoy panoramic vistas in Mondim de Basto?

Mondim de Basto is renowned for its spectacular viewpoints. The Senhora da Graça Sanctuary on Monte Farinha offers expansive views. Within Alvão Natural Park, the Barreiro viewpoint provides excellent perspectives. Other notable spots include Miradouro do Fojo, which overlooks the Fisgas de Ermelo Waterfalls, and viewpoints at Lomba Gorda, Alto do Velão, and Torrão.

Are there family-friendly attractions or activities in Mondim de Basto?

Families can enjoy the Municipal Urban Park in the civic center of Mondim, which features gardens, a playground, and a lake. The Zona Verde is another urban oasis offering swimming pools, a restaurant, a playground, and sports facilities, making it a popular gathering spot for all ages. Exploring traditional villages like Ermelo Village can also be an enriching experience for families.

Can I visit traditional villages near Mondim de Basto?

Absolutely. You can explore traditional mountain villages such as Ermelo Village, known for its granite houses and views over the waterfalls. Travassos, part of the 'Aldeias de Portugal' network, also showcases authentic rural life with its unique architecture and public wash houses, offering a glimpse into the region's cultural heritage.

What is the best time of year to visit Mondim de Basto for outdoor activities?

The warmer months are ideal for enjoying natural swimming pools at the Fisgas de Ermelo Waterfalls and other river spots. Autumn is particularly beautiful for cycling the Tâmega Line Ecotrail, as the falling leaves create a vibrant display of colors. Spring and early summer also offer pleasant temperatures for hiking and exploring the natural parks.

Are there opportunities for mountain biking in the Mondim de Basto region?

Yes, the mountainous terrain around Mondim de Basto is well-suited for mountain biking. You can find challenging routes that explore the Alvão Natural Park and surrounding areas. For specific trails, refer to the MTB Trails around Mondim De Basto guide, which includes routes like the 'Nossa Senhora da Graça Loop' and the 'Monte Farinha and Senhora da Graça Loop'.

What kind of natural landscapes can I expect to see in Mondim de Basto?

Mondim de Basto boasts a rich variety of natural landscapes. You'll encounter the dramatic cliffs and cascading waters of the Fisgas de Ermelo, the sprawling granite peaks and verdant valleys of Alvão Natural Park, and the serene views along the Tâmega River. The region is characterized by lush valleys, distant mountains, and unique biodiversity, including wildlife like otters and eagles.

Are there any unique cultural sites or points of interest in the town of Mondim de Basto itself?

Within the town, you can wander through the historic center's old streets, admiring granite houses adorned with flowers and intricate alleyways. The 16th-century Capela do Senhor, a Public Interest Property with a coffered ceiling, is also worth a visit. The Municipal Urban Park and Zona Verde offer modern recreational spaces that reflect the town's community life.

Can I experience local winemaking traditions near Mondim de Basto?

Just a short drive from Mondim de Basto, the Vila Real Vineyards offer guided tasting tours. You can gain insights into traditional winemaking processes amidst picturesque landscapes. Nearby options like Quinta de Santa Cristina and Quinta da Raza provide excellent opportunities to sample the region's fine wines.
